Pete Wentz And Ashlee Simpson Don't Have Name Picked Out

This makes total sense to me.  I know some people have names picked out for their children since before they are even pregnant but Ashlee Simpson and Pete Wentz are choosing to wait to meet their little one before they choose a a name for him or her.  Pete says,

"I want to meet them first. My brother was almost a Duncan,
and he's Andrew now. I think it might have ruined his life more if he
was a Duncan."

The name just needs to work whether the baby grows up to be a "a rock star or a senator."

As for how Ashlee is doing right now, 

She's "excited, she's anxious...I think she wants it to be over. She just
wants to not be pregnant any more. She wants to have it because it's,
like, a struggle to go up and down the stairs...going out in public's
insane.

"She's hot all the time," added Wentz. "She's like 'I wish I was in
Canada right now.' Our room temperature is set to, like, 34 degrees.
It's insane!"

Pete added that he's "permanently on call," and that the birth could be "happen at any point now."
